STEPANAKERT — On 28 April Artsakh Republic President Bako Sahakian received Dr. Pamela Steiner, lecturer of the Harvard University, great granddaughter of Henry Morgenthau, USA ambassador to the Ottoman Empire during the First World War, NKR President’s Press Office reports.

A number of political, humanitarian and psychological issues related to the history of Armenian people and Artsakh were touched upon during the meeting.

President Sahakian noted that Henry Morgenthau had always enjoyed great respect by the Armenian people and qualified the life and activity of the diplomat as a standard of high professionalism and morality.

Foreign minister Karen Mirzoian and other officials partook in the meeting.
